The loading ramp was on an old Bulleid chassis, I believe; it was owned by MAT, who loaded/unloaded cars and Land-Rovers at the old 'Military Platform'. The car-carrier was ex-works, part of a very large number being delivered in readiness for the (delayed) opening of the Channel Tunnel; sometimes, almost the entire load of the Nord-Pas-de-Calais were new wagons at this time, as there were car-carriers and container flats for the Tunnel, along with new flats for Freightliner, as well as wagons like those Buxton Lime Industry ones shown earlier.
